To diagnose noisy plumbing, it is very important to establish initial whether the unwanted noises take place on the system's inlet side-in other words, when water is turned on-or on the drainpipe side. Noises on the inlet side have differed causes: excessive water stress, used valve and also faucet components, improperly linked pumps or other home appliances, inaccurately positioned pipe fasteners, and also plumbing runs containing a lot of limited bends or various other limitations. Noises on the drain side normally originate from inadequate location or, just like some inlet side sound, a design including limited bends.
Hissing
Hissing noise that happens when a faucet is opened somewhat generally signals extreme water stress. Consult your regional public utility if you think this trouble; it will be able to inform you the water stress in your area and also can install a pressurereducing shutoff on the inbound water system pipeline if necessary.
Thudding
Thudding noise, usually accompanied by shuddering pipes, when a faucet or device valve is shut off is a problem called water hammer. The noise as well as resonance are caused by the resounding wave of stress in the water, which all of a sudden has no location to go. Occasionally opening a valve that discharges water quickly into an area of piping containing a limitation, elbow joint, or tee installation can generate the same condition.
Water hammer can normally be healed by installing fittings called air chambers or shock absorbers in the plumbing to which the problem valves or taps are attached. These devices allow the shock wave produced by the halted circulation of water to dissipate airborne they have, which (unlike water) is compressible.
Older plumbing systems may have short vertical sections of capped pipeline behind wall surfaces on tap runs for the same objective; these can eventually full of water, lowering or destroying their effectiveness. The remedy is to drain pipes the water supply completely by turning off the primary water valve and opening all faucets. Then open the main supply valve and close the faucets one by one, starting with the faucet nearest the valve and ending with the one farthest away.
Chattering or Screeching
Intense chattering or screeching that occurs when a valve or faucet is turned on, and that usually vanishes when the installation is opened totally, signals loosened or defective internal parts. The service is to replace the valve or faucet with a brand-new one.
Pumps as well as devices such as cleaning devices as well as dishwashing machines can transfer motor noise to pipelines if they are poorly attached. Connect such products to plumbing with plastic or rubber hoses-never stiff pipe-to isolate them.
Other Inlet Side Noises
Creaking, squealing, damaging, breaking, as well as tapping typically are caused by the development or tightening of pipelines, typically copper ones supplying hot water. The sounds take place as the pipelines slide against loose bolts or strike neighboring home framework. You can usually determine the place of the issue if the pipes are revealed; simply comply with the sound when the pipelines are making noise. Probably you will discover a loose pipeline wall mount or an area where pipelines exist so near to floor joists or various other mounting pieces that they clatter versus them. Connecting foam pipe insulation around the pipelines at the point of call must treat the issue. Make certain straps and wall mounts are secure as well as provide appropriate support. Where feasible, pipe bolts should be connected to huge architectural elements such as structure walls rather than to framing; doing so reduces the transmission of resonances from plumbing to surfaces that can enhance as well as transfer them. If attaching bolts to framework is inevitable, cover pipes with insulation or other resistant material where they call fasteners, as well as sandwich completions of new fasteners in between rubber washers when mounting them.
Dealing with plumbing runs that suffer from flow-restricting limited or countless bends is a last option that needs to be carried out just after consulting a competent plumbing service provider. Unfortunately, this circumstance is relatively usual in older houses that may not have actually been constructed with indoor plumbing or that have seen a number of remodels, specifically by beginners.
Drain Noise
On the drain side of plumbing, the chief objectives are to remove surfaces that can be struck by falling or hurrying water and also to insulate pipes to include inevitable noises.
In new building and construction, bath tubs, shower stalls, commodes, and wallmounted sinks as well as containers must be set on or versus resilient underlayments to reduce the transmission of sound with them. Water-saving bathrooms as well as taps are much less loud than standard models; install them instead of older types even if codes in your area still permit making use of older fixtures.
Drainpipes that do not run up and down to the cellar or that branch into straight pipe runs sustained at flooring joists or various other framing present especially frustrating sound problems. Such pipes are big sufficient to emit substantial vibration; they also bring considerable quantities of water, that makes the scenario even worse. In brand-new building, define cast-iron dirt pipes (the big pipes that drain toilets) if you can afford them. Their massiveness contains much of the noise made by water going through them. Likewise, stay clear of transmitting drains in wall surfaces shown to rooms and rooms where people gather. Walls containing drains need to be soundproofed as was defined previously, making use of dual panels of sound-insulating fiber board and also wallboard. Pipelines themselves can be covered with unique fiberglass insulation created the objective; such pipes have an invulnerable plastic skin (sometimes containing lead). Outcomes are not always sufficient.

Cracks or Ticks
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.
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.
Bangs
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
